As the restaurant industry continues to grow, suppliers must keep pace by offering high-quality kitchenware products. This article outlines five essential items that every restaurant supplier should consider including in their inventory.
Non-stick cookware is a staple in commercial kitchens, reducing the need for oil and making cleanup easier. Wholesale suppliers should ensure they provide a variety of pots and pans designed for heavy-duty use.
Kitchen knives are crucial for any culinary operation. Offering a range of knives suited for different tasks can attract B2B clients looking for reliability and performance in their kitchenware.
Serving platters that can withstand the rigors of service are essential for any restaurant. Suppliers should offer both aesthetic and functional options to cater to diverse clientele.
With food safety regulations tightening, high-quality food storage containers are necessary for every restaurant. Suppliers can thrive by providing options that are both durable and versatile.
As sustainability becomes a priority for many restaurants, offering eco-friendly utensils can set suppliers apart. This includes biodegradable options and products made from recycled materials.
By focusing on these essential kitchenware products, restaurant suppliers can position themselves as leaders in the B2B market, meeting the diverse needs of their clients effectively.
